Andrés Eugenio Rillón Roman ( Spanish: Andrés Eugenio Rillón Roman) ( Viña del Mar , Valparaiso Region ; December 27, 1929 - Santiago , Metropolitan Region (Chile) ; January 5, 2017 ) - Chilean lawyer , comedian and actor .

He studied law at the University of Chile and in 1963 received the title of lawyer. He also studied cinema at the Catholic University of Chile .
He was the head of the Chilean Electoral Service from 1965 to 1977, while from 1965 to 1968 - in the status of an acting.
He acted as an actor, film producer and director of the theater. Also for 10 years (1976-1986) he was a television critic in the newspaper El Mercurio and a humorous columnist in the magazine Qué Pasa (1972-1973) and the evening newspaper La Segunda .
On television, he was a member of the cast of comedy shows Jappening con ja (1983-1989) and Mediomundo (1985-1992), where he became famous for his character Don Pio. He also starred in a series of commercials for the Winter Sausage Company in the early 1990s. The movie starred in the films King of San Gregorio (2007) and Héroes: el asilo contra la opresión (2015).
